At a stop at Grand Mart International Food ... WebMay 14, 2024 · Groceries, or “food for home consumption” are taxable in Virginia, but at a reduced rate of 2.5% throughout the state. (Source) In Virginia, the definition of food for home consumption includes most staple grocery food items and cold prepared foods packaged for home consumption. WebJan 25, 2024 · RICHMOND, Va. — Virginia is one of 13 states that imposes a sales tax on groceries. On the campaign trail, Governor-to-be Glenn Youngkin pledged to get rid of it. But he can't do it alone by ...
WebMar 24, 2024 · The Democratic-controlled Virginia Senate approved a partial cut of the tax, voting to remove the 1.5% that goes to the state but keep the 1% earmarked for local governments.
